MemMachine

MemMachine empowers AI agents with lasting memory, enhancing personalization and intelligence for richer user interac...

Visit

Published on:

November 6, 2025

Category:

Pricing:

MemMachine application interface and features

About MemMachine

MemMachine is an innovative open-source memory layer designed to transform AI agents and applications into intelligent, personalized assistants. Unlike traditional AI applications that begin each interaction from scratch, MemMachine allows applications to learn, store, and recall data from previous sessions, which significantly enriches user experiences. Its persistent memory capability builds sophisticated, evolving user profiles by maintaining context across interactions, making it an invaluable tool for businesses and developers aiming to create more engaging and responsive AI applications. MemMachine is ideal for teams focused on enhancing user engagement through personalization, whether in customer service, healthcare, or any domain where understanding user preferences is crucial. Its flexibility and robust integration capabilities position it as a key asset in the ongoing evolution of AI technology.

Features of MemMachine

Persistent Memory

MemMachine’s unique persistent memory feature allows it to maintain user data across multiple sessions and interactions. This capability enables AI agents to build an evolving understanding of user preferences and behaviors, leading to enhanced personalization and a more intuitive user experience.

Multi-Platform Integration

MemMachine supports seamless integration with various platforms, including OpenAI, AWS Bedrock, and Ollama. Its MCP server capability allows developers to connect their applications effortlessly, ensuring that the memory layer operates smoothly across different environments and enhances overall functionality.

Flexible Deployment

With MemMachine, users can choose how to deploy their AI applications—locally, in the cloud, or through pip installation. This flexibility provides full data control, allowing developers to tailor the deployment according to their specific needs and infrastructure.

Open-Source Community

As an open-source tool, MemMachine comes with comprehensive documentation and robust community support. This encourages collaboration and innovation, providing users with access to a wealth of resources and knowledge-sharing opportunities that can enhance their development experience.

Use Cases of MemMachine

Personalized Customer Support

MemMachine can be used to create customer service AI agents that remember previous interactions, helping to resolve issues faster and more efficiently. By recalling customer preferences and history, these agents provide tailored support, improving customer satisfaction and loyalty.

Context-Aware Healthcare Assistants

In healthcare, MemMachine enhances patient interaction by allowing AI assistants to remember vital information about patients, such as medical history and preferences. This leads to a more personalized experience, helping healthcare providers deliver better care and support.

Intelligent Learning Companions

Educational applications can leverage MemMachine to create intelligent tutoring systems that adapt to each student’s learning style and pace. By retaining information about past lessons and performance, these systems can provide customized learning experiences that improve student outcomes.

Enhanced Team Collaboration Tools

MemMachine can be integrated into collaboration platforms to build AI assistants that remember team dynamics and project histories. This enables proactive insights and suggestions based on past interactions, streamlining workflows and enhancing productivity across teams.

Frequently Asked Questions

What makes MemMachine different from traditional AI applications?

MemMachine stands out due to its persistent memory feature, which allows AI agents to remember information across multiple sessions. This leads to more personalized and context-aware interactions, unlike traditional AI that starts fresh each time.

Can MemMachine be integrated with existing applications?

Yes, MemMachine offers multi-platform integration capabilities, enabling it to work seamlessly with various platforms like OpenAI, AWS Bedrock, and Ollama. This makes it easy to enhance existing applications with its memory features.

Is MemMachine suitable for all industries?

Absolutely. MemMachine can be utilized across various sectors, including healthcare, customer service, education, and team collaboration, to create personalized and context-aware AI agents that improve user engagement and satisfaction.

How does MemMachine ensure data privacy and control?

MemMachine offers flexible deployment options, allowing users to run it locally or in the cloud. This enables teams to maintain full control over their data while leveraging the powerful memory capabilities of the platform.

You may also like:

Admanage AI - AI tool for productivity

Admanage AI

AdManage.ai helps you launch ads 10x faster. Launch instantly to Meta, TikTok, Pinterest, Google, YouTube, Snapchat, and Axon. Join top advertisers.

Incentise - AI tool for productivity

Incentise

Incentise is an AI-powered incentive and acknowledgment platform that helps brands turn promotional offers into visible, shareable social proof.

HarvestMyData - AI tool for productivity

HarvestMyData

Extract Instagram followers' emails in minutes. Get business contacts, bios, and Linktree URLs. No proxies, no login required. $3-49 per job.